Transaction b8d386f6d6b2bf8a248213c94f91596e7000106b6701f75ea52ee8a3039c7ba2
1 Input
1 Output
-
b8d386f6d6b2bf8a248213c94f91596e7000106b6701f75ea52ee8a3039c7ba2:0
- value
- 2628198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8eb31c10fa573158a4df0a946350fd3137a0046 OP_EQUAL
- address
- 3NvaSdz7dEF2PutYDJdFdJYUWHtsG5wvCT